イーサリアム以外に注目のスマートコントラクト暗号資産 (仮想通貨)
スマートコントラクトは、ブロックチェーン技術を活用した自動実行可能な契約であり、金融、サプライチェーン管理、投票システムなど、様々な分野での応用が期待されています。イーサリアムがスマートコントラクトプラットフォームの先駆けとして広く知られていますが、近年、イーサリアムの代替となる、あるいは補完する形で、多くのスマートコントラクト暗号資産(仮想通貨)が登場しています。本稿では、イーサリアム以外の注目すべきスマートコントラクト暗号資産について、その特徴、技術的な基盤、そして将来性について詳細に解説します。
1. スマートコントラクトの基礎とイーサリアムの限界
スマートコントラクトは、事前に定義された条件が満たされた場合に自動的に実行されるコードです。これにより、仲介者を介さずに、安全かつ透明性の高い取引を実現できます。イーサリアムは、スマートコントラクトを最初に導入した主要なプラットフォームであり、Solidityというプログラミング言語を用いて開発されています。しかし、イーサリアムには、スケーラビリティ問題、高いガス代(取引手数料)、そして複雑なプログラミング言語といった限界が存在します。これらの課題を克服するために、様々な代替プラットフォームが開発されています。
2. イーサリアムの代替プラットフォーム
2.1. Cardano (ADA)
Cardanoは、科学的な哲学に基づいて開発されたブロックチェーンプラットフォームです。Ouroborosというプルーフ・オブ・ステーク(PoS)コンセンサスアルゴリズムを採用しており、エネルギー効率が高く、スケーラビリティに優れています。Cardanoは、Haskellという関数型プログラミング言語を用いてスマートコントラクトを開発しており、セキュリティと信頼性の高いシステム構築を目指しています。また、Cardanoは、レイヤー2ソリューションであるHydraの開発にも注力しており、さらなるスケーラビリティの向上を図っています。
2.2. Solana (SOL)
Solanaは、高速なトランザクション処理能力を特徴とするブロックチェーンプラットフォームです。Proof of History (PoH)という独自のコンセンサスアルゴリズムを採用しており、高いスループットを実現しています。Solanaは、Rustというプログラミング言語を用いてスマートコントラクトを開発しており、開発者にとって使いやすい環境を提供しています。Solanaは、分散型金融(DeFi)アプリケーションやNFT(非代替性トークン)プラットフォームとして急速に成長しています。
2.3. Polkadot (DOT)
Polkadotは、異なるブロックチェーン間の相互運用性を実現するためのプラットフォームです。パラチェーンと呼ばれる独立したブロックチェーンを接続し、それぞれの特性を活かしたアプリケーション開発を可能にします。Polkadotは、Substrateというフレームワークを用いてブロックチェーンを構築しており、柔軟性と拡張性に優れています。Polkadotは、異なるブロックチェーン間のデータや資産の交換を容易にし、ブロックチェーンエコシステムの拡大に貢献しています。
2.4. Avalanche (AVAX)
Avalancheは、高速かつ低コストなトランザクション処理を特徴とするブロックチェーンプラットフォームです。Avalancheコンセンサスプロトコルを採用しており、高いスループットとファイナリティを実現しています。Avalancheは、Solidityというプログラミング言語をサポートしており、イーサリアムの開発者が容易に移行できます。Avalancheは、DeFiアプリケーションやエンタープライズ向けのソリューションとして注目されています。
2.5. Tezos (XTZ)
Tezosは、自己修正機能を備えたブロックチェーンプラットフォームです。プロトコルをアップグレードする際に、コミュニティの合意を得ることで、柔軟かつ迅速な変更を可能にします。Tezosは、Michelsonという独自のプログラミング言語を用いてスマートコントラクトを開発しており、形式検証によるセキュリティの向上を図っています。Tezosは、ガバナンス機能とセキュリティを重視するプロジェクトに適しています。
3. その他の注目スマートコントラクト暗号資産
3.1. Algorand (ALGO)
Algorandは、Pure Proof-of-Stake (PPoS)コンセンサスアルゴリズムを採用したブロックチェーンプラットフォームです。高いセキュリティとスケーラビリティを実現しており、高速なトランザクション処理能力を誇ります。Algorandは、スマートコントラクトの開発環境を提供しており、様々なアプリケーションの構築を支援しています。
3.2. EOS (EOS)
EOSは、Delegated Proof-of-Stake (DPoS)コンセンサスアルゴリズムを採用したブロックチェーンプラットフォームです。高速なトランザクション処理能力と低い手数料を特徴としています。EOSは、WebAssembly (WASM)を用いてスマートコントラクトを開発しており、様々なプログラミング言語をサポートしています。
3.3. TRON (TRX)
TRONは、エンターテイメントコンテンツの分散化を目指すブロックチェーンプラットフォームです。スマートコントラクトの開発環境を提供しており、コンテンツクリエイターが直接ファンとつながることを可能にします。TRONは、Solidityというプログラミング言語をサポートしており、イーサリアムの開発者が容易に移行できます。
4. スマートコントラクト暗号資産の将来性
スマートコントラクト暗号資産は、ブロックチェーン技術の進化とともに、ますます重要な役割を果たすと考えられます。DeFi、NFT、サプライチェーン管理、投票システムなど、様々な分野での応用が期待されており、従来のビジネスモデルに変革をもたらす可能性があります。しかし、スマートコントラクトのセキュリティ、スケーラビリティ、そして規制といった課題も存在します。これらの課題を克服することで、スマートコントラクト暗号資産は、より広く普及し、社会に貢献していくでしょう。
5. 結論
イーサリアムは、スマートコントラクトプラットフォームの先駆けとして重要な役割を果たしましたが、その限界から、多くの代替プラットフォームが登場しています。Cardano、Solana、Polkadot、Avalanche、Tezosといったプラットフォームは、それぞれ独自の技術的な特徴を持ち、異なるユースケースに適しています。これらのプラットフォームは、イーサリアムの課題を克服し、ブロックチェーンエコシステムの拡大に貢献していくでしょう。スマートコントラクト暗号資産は、今後も進化を続け、社会に大きな影響を与える可能性を秘めています。投資家は、各プラットフォームの技術的な特徴、将来性、そしてリスクを十分に理解した上で、投資判断を行う必要があります。



